The Benefits-First template focuses on turning technical features into clear, customer-focused benefits. Here’s how to structure a Benefits-First product description:
Here’s a quick comparison of how features can be reframed into benefits:
Feature | Weak Description | Benefits-First Description |
---|---|---|
Waterproof Material | Made with Gore-Tex fabric | Stay dry and comfortable in any weather |
4K Resolution | Features 3840 x 2160 pixels | See every detail in stunning clarity |
12-Hour Battery | Contains 5000mAh battery | Work all day without hunting for outlets |
Natural Ingredients | Contains aloe vera | Soothe and nourish sensitive skin naturally |
This approach works. Take Dr. Squatch’s Pine Tar soap as an example: "Made with real pine extract, this all-star bar is as tough as a freshly cut bat...a heavy-hitter knocks out grime with its gritty composition and ultra-manly, woodsy scent".

Crafting SEO-friendly product descriptions can drive more organic traffic and boost sales. This template is designed to help you create descriptions that rank well and connect with potential customers.
An SEO-friendly product description balances keyword use with clear, engaging content. As Michael Keenan from Shopify puts it: "The number one rule for good ecommerce SEO is to write for people first - not for the search engine web crawlers".
Component | Purpose | Example Implementation |
---|---|---|
Title | Focus on the main keyword | "Squalane Vitamin C Rose Oil" |
Meta Description | Include secondary keywords | 150-160 characters highlighting benefits |
Body Content | Naturally integrate keywords | 150-300 words of unique content |
Image Alt Text | Descriptive and keyword-rich | Product name + key features |
URL Structure | Clean and keyword-focused | category/product-name-keyword |

Comparison templates help buyers easily evaluate similar products side by side. By focusing on clarity and structure, this format simplifies decision-making and highlights key differences effectively.
This template organizes product details into straightforward sections for easy comparison:
Component | Purpose | Example Format |
---|---|---|
Feature Matrix | Compare key attributes side by side | Checkmarks or detailed specs |
Price Analysis | Break down costs and value offered | Dollar amounts with savings noted |
Technical Specs | Highlight measurements and capabilities | Specifications table |
User Benefits | Show practical advantages for users | Real-world use cases |
Social Proof | Display customer feedback and ratings | Star ratings and review counts |

Expanding into global markets takes more than just translating words. This template is designed to help you tailor product descriptions for different regions effectively.
Section | Original Content | Localization Considerations |
---|---|---|
Product Title | Main product name and key features | Cultural naming norms, local search habits |
Key Benefits | Primary selling points | Regional pain points, cultural preferences |
Technical Details | Specs and features | Local measurement units, regional standards |
Usage Instructions | How-to details | Regional safety guidelines, local regulations |
Call-to-Action | Purchase prompts | Cultural buying behaviors, local payment options |
